Group Psychotherapy

Plover Psychological Clinic, LLC is a Group Psychotherapy practice in Plover, WI with healthcare providers who have special training and skill in providing psychotherapy and group cohesiveness for people experiencing similar mental health challenges. Group Psychotherapists at Plover Psychological Clinic, LLC perform group therapy to improve mental health in safe, comfortable settings. Group Psychotherapy is the care of the mental health of a group of people, following the principles of The Theory and Practice of Group Psychotherapy by Irvin D. Yalom. Significant diseases and conditions treated at Group Psychotherapy practices include stress, social anxiety, depression, harassment, relationships, work, anger issues, substance abuse, and suicide.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Group Psychotherapy practices include group therapy that instills: safety, catharsis, unity, support, hope, interpersonal learning, acceptance, conflict resolution, and socialization technique development via behavior imitation.

A psychologist who specializes in group psychology and group psychotherapy that is an evidenced-based specialty that prepares group leaders to identify and capitalize on developmental and healing possibilities embedded in the interpersonal/intrapersonal functioning of individual group members as well as collectively for the group. Emphasis is placed on the use of group dynamics to assist and treat individual group members. The specialty is applicable to all age groups, children, adolescents, adults and older adults, for a wide variety of conditions and concerns, and in numerous and diverse settings.
